怎样用shell 编写把一台服务器tomcat目录下的log(我把tomcat的log切成按小时存了)实时复制到另一服务器上

怎样用shell 编写把一台服务器tomcat目录下的log(我把tomcat的log切成按小时存了)实时复制到另一服务器上,第1张

$ man scp
eg $ scp /home/taomcat/log/2012-07-02-01log user@host:/home/user/tomcat_log/

scp是通过ssh复制文件,比用ftp方便
但你需要配置成RSA Key认证的方式——避免每次都要输入密码
$ man crontab

crontab可以定时执行一个任务,你可以让它定时调用你复制log的script

原理?不知道怎么理解你的提问
我只能按常规来说,
1购买一个正规品牌的服务器,不能是太低端。当然也得根据你们公司的情况和条件购买
2“配件”一定要齐全,例如 空调 UPS后备电源
3安装正版的服务器专用 *** 作系统和软件
4不要安装一些跟工作不相关的软件,例如私人的FTP空间等,
5配备一个专业的网管
基本上就这么多

服务器是台性能高一点的电脑,散热性能一定要强,耐用性比一般的电脑要好。\x0d\一般的服务器要求常年累月24小时开机,偶尔也需要关机维护一次。\x0d\服务器之所以得名是因为他在局域网中充当数据存储和交换的作用,这些作用并不是他自己独有的,需要SQL Server、Oracle、IIS、Tomacat、*** GateWay、花生壳等软件环境去运作,能通过它存储数据、访问数据、交换数据,服务于客户端,这才叫服务器。\x0d\一般的电脑也可以打到这个要求,只是你不可能长年累月开着,普通电脑是吃不消的。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zz/12570778.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-26
下一篇 2023-05-26

发表评论

登录后才能评论

评论列表(0条)

保存